Women's experience with home-based self-sampling for human papillomavirus testing

F Sultana, R Mullins, DR English, JA Simpson, KT Drennan, S Heley, CD Wrede, JML Brotherton, M Saville, DM Gertig

BMC Cancer | Published : 2015

Abstract

Background: Increasing cervical screening coverage by reaching inadequately screened groups is essential for improving the effectiveness of cervical screening programs. Offering HPV self-sampling to women who are never or under-screened can improve screening participation, however participation varies widely between settings. Information on women's experience with self-sampling and preferences for future self-sampling screening is essential for programs to optimize participation. Methods: The survey was conducted as part of a larger trial ("iPap") investigating the effect of HPV self-sampling on participation of never and under-screened women in Victoria, Australia.
